Angela M. Bosco‐Lauth is a scholar working on Infectious Diseases,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and Agronomy and Crop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Angela M. Bosco‐Lauth has authored 84 papers receiving a total of 1.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 65 papers in Infectious Diseases, 45 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and 16 papers in Agronomy and Crop Science. Recurrent topics in Angela M. Bosco‐Lauth’s work include Viral Infections and Vectors (46 papers), Mosquito-borne diseases and control (42 papers) and Malaria Research and Control (16 papers). Angela M. Bosco‐Lauth is often cited by papers focused on Viral Infections and Vectors (46 papers), Mosquito-borne diseases and control (42 papers) and Malaria Research and Control (16 papers). Angela M. Bosco‐Lauth collaborates with scholars based in United States, Australia and Canada. Angela M. Bosco‐Lauth's co-authors include Richard A. Bowen, Airn E. Hartwig, Aaron C. Brault, J. Jeffrey Root, Stephanie Porter, Sue VandeWoude, Nicole M. Nemeth, Rachel M. Maison, Paul Gordy and Alex D. Byas and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Environmental Science & Technology and PLoS ONE.
